Corporate Social Responsibility(CSR)

BASIC APPROACH

OLFA conducts business activities in various countries and regions around the world. These activities include procuring raw materials and supplies, as well as outsourcing and subcontracting across a wide range of industries and locations.

Meanwhile, global expectations for CSR are evolving and becoming more complex. These expectations address critical issues such as climate change mitigation, environmental stewardship, respect for human rights, and improving working conditions.

These responsibilities extend beyond our own operations to the entire supply chain. To address these challenges and ensure stable, sustainable procurement, OLFA has implemented extensive policies that demonstrate our dedication to ethical and responsible business practices.

CSR PROCUREMENT

OLFA takes a proactive approach to CSR by establishing its CSR Procurement Policy as the foundation of its responsible initiatives, with the aim of building an ethical supply chain that addresses environmental and social responsibilities, safeguards human rights, and ensures product quality and stable supply.

To ensure the effective implementation of this policy throughout the supply chain, OLFA has established the “CSR Procurement Action Guideline” and the “Supplier Code of Conduct,” which set forth clear requirements and expectations for compliance by both OLFA and its business partners.

HUMAN RIGHTS & LABOR

OLFA believes that “a business flourishes through trust by society,” and its operations depend on resources entrusted to it, including human talent, financial capital, and essential materials. With this trust comes responsibility, and OLFA must maximize these resources, create meaningful value through its activities, and give it back to society.

Moreover, our business is supported by a wide network of stakeholders, including not only our employees working within the group, but also our customers who use our products and services, our business partners involved in procurement and sales, and all those closely connected to and supporting our business.

Based on this recognition, OLFA has established a Human Rights and Labor Policy and strives to fulfill its social responsibilities so that all stakeholders can lead healthy and happy lives, both physically and mentally.

CSR MANAGEMENT

To promote CSR procurement throughout the entire OLFA Group, including both domestic and overseas affiliates, and to mitigate risks related to the globalization of supply chains, OLFA has formed a CSR Procurement Working Group.

The group plays a pivotal role in evaluating suppliers’ CSR practices, collaborating on customer-led CSR procurement surveys, and promoting responsible procurement throughout our global network. Additionally, the group regularly reports on CSR procurement progress and risk mitigation activities to the CSR Promotion Committee and the Management ensuring informed decision-making and transparent communication across the organization.
